Commercial Solar Federal Investment Tax Credits (FITC)

A person places a coin into a piggy bank against the backdrop of solar panels at sunset, symbolizing financial savings and renewable energy investments.

The Federal Investment Tax Credit for solar allows commercial property owners to offset up to 30% of solar installation costs, boosting energy savings and property value.
